What is Geometry Dash All About?

At its core, geometry dash is a rhythm-based platformer. You control a small icon (typically a cube, but you unlock more as you play) that moves relentlessly to the right across the screen. Your objective is to navigate through a series of obstacles, including spikes, blocks, and drops, while keeping pace with a driving electronic music soundtrack.

The simplicity is what makes it so appealing. You control your icon with a single action: pressing the jump button (typically spacebar, left mouse click, or tapping the screen on mobile). Time your jumps perfectly to avoid obstacles and survive until the end of the level. Seems easy, right? Think again!

Gameplay: A Symphony of Precision and Patience

The gameplay is divided into levels, each with its unique challenges and musical theme. As you progress, the levels become increasingly complex, introducing new gameplay mechanics and faster tempos. Here's a breakdown of what you can expect:

  • The Cube: The foundation of the game. You jump over obstacles. The initial levels focus heavily on mastering this basic mechanic.
  • The Ship: Introduced early on, the Ship allows you to control your vertical movement by holding down the jump button to ascend and releasing to descend. Precise control is essential.
  • The Ball: This gameplay style reverses gravity with each jump. Timing is crucial to navigate tight spaces.
  • The UFO: Similar to the Ship, but with shorter bursts of flight. This adds a layer of frantic clicking to your gameplay.
  • The Wave: Perhaps the most challenging, the Wave moves diagonally. Holding the jump button shifts your direction, requiring incredible coordination.
  • The Robot: Allows for multi-jumps by holding the jump button, enabling you to reach higher platforms.
  • The Spider: A teleporter that switches between the floor and ceiling with each tap, demanding lightning-fast reactions.

The levels also incorporate portals that switch you between these different forms, sometimes multiple times within a single level, keeping you on your toes. Moreover, keep an eye out for orbs and pads that can either jump you automatically to a high location or trigger special effects.

Helpful Hints for Aspiring Geometry Dash Masters

Geometry Dash can be tough, but with practice and a few pointers, you'll be conquering levels in no time. Here are some tips to get you started:

  • Practice Mode is Your Friend: Don't be afraid to use practice mode! This mode allows you to place checkpoints throughout the level, letting you repeatedly practice difficult sections without restarting from the beginning.
  • Listen to the Music: The levels are designed to sync with the music, so paying attention to the beat can help you anticipate upcoming obstacles. The music is your guide!
  • Memorization is Key: Certain parts of levels require precise timing and memorization. Repetition is key to mastering these sections. Use practice mode extensively.
  • Adjust Your Offset: Geometry Dash has an offset setting that can help align the gameplay with the music. If you're experiencing input lag, adjusting the offset can make a significant difference.

  • Explore User-Created Levels: The game boasts a vast library of user-created levels, offering a nearly endless stream of content and challenges. Some are easier, some are incredibly difficult. Experiment and find levels that suit your skill level.
  • Watch Gameplay Videos: Watching experienced players tackle levels can provide valuable insights into optimal strategies and timing.
